The Wildezine

https://www.shutterstock.com/zh/image-illustration/phosphine-gas-cloud-decks-venus-3d-1815438263

Possible Sign of Life on Venus

Yili Bai, Staff Writer
December 17, 2020
Load More Stories
Activate Search
Venus